r7 - 26 Oct 2006 - 14:36:33 - KatieCappsParlanteYou are here: OSAF >  Journal Web  >  DevelopmentHome > DeveloperPlatformProject > Platform20061017

Platform team meeting 17 October 2006

Agenda

  • Q: What is on your mind today?
  • α4
  • staff meeting demos?
    • vtodo

Notes

  • Q: What is on your mind today?
    • Heikki: performance
    • Andi: bugs, several seem to be reaching closure today 7016, 7019. P2P jabber based sharing.
    • Grant: cake. birthdays. getting older. bugs.
    • Morgen: looking forward to closing out alpha4 and starting eim work. looking at one remaining bug, 7019 -- interested in hearing about the status. (Grant -- side effect from deferred deletion, modifications don't get propagated. Underlying bug, remove the occurrences list, doesn't propagate the way we'd expect. Several bugs at once. Grant has a unit test which reproduces the bug. Uses the memory conduit. Andi will take the bug.)
    • Bear: Recurring theme, sometimes the build environment makes things hard for the developers, spend some mental time on how can we simplify the build environment.
  • Build environment: readline issue
    • Bear is working on readln in python in windows. Bear needs to go make the python build have no parameters, then start adding them back. Heikki thinks it has never worked on windows. Bear says it supports it, but perhaps other dependencies on cygwin, etc. Andi suspects the way he made it work on mac could be made to work on windows. Bear: runs a different configure script on windows than osx. Andi: 2.4 doesn't depend on configure, go edit some file. Look at mac specific patch for osx. There is a file called modules? Commented out by default, you can comment it in correctly. Bear will ask on the Python list. Heikki Cygwin python. Grant: they manage to build readline support. Heikki/Bear: but they have a bunch of other support available with the cygwin libs. Bear: Twisted guys had to deal with this. Readline.py.
  • Development tools you use day to day, documentation etc. so they can be shared with everyone else.
    • svk: a small handful of people use it. Instructions for new developers, etc. Journal pages by vinu and jared have info, perhaps collect information. Email bear with links to names, build up informal list, post to dev list and make it public.
    • subzilla
    • pdb (instead of using print statements)
  • α4
    • bug fixing

Status

Katie

  • Progress
    • spent a fair amount of time dogfooding/testing chandler, reproducing bugs and trying to get better info for debugging
    • job description for business strategy and development position, reviewing resumes
    • reviewed the budget with the ops team
    • branding activities, including planning for naming exercise and a meeting to review positioning statements
    • bug council for α4
  • Plan
    • catch up on chandler dev summaries
    • continue dogfooding/testing
    • branding name exercise
    • draft positioning statement
    • continue reviewing resumes, networking for candidates, scheduling interviews

Andi

http://kumu.osafoundation.org/~vajda/logs.cgi

Grant

  • Progress
    • 6905 Can't import absolute-time (er, "Custom") reminders
    • 6924 More stamping-as-annotation cleanup
    • 6921 Can't import an oracle-generated .ics event (RDATE problem)?
    • 6920 Error synching Office Calendar
    • 6953 "No attribute 'preferredKind'" in Flickr
    • Calconnect IOP Testing feedback
    • Discussions with JeffreyHarris, MimiYin and SheilaMooney on recurrence, triage status, last modified, etc.
    • Looked into some performance issues with creating new occurrences, related to 6775, and also discussed in this chandler-dev@ thread.
    • 6838 Occurrences aren't being deleted when the trash is emptied
    • 7009 event disappears after dragging to trash & choosing 'all future'
    • 7017 error changing recurring event from weekly to biweekly
    • 7034 Intermittent failures in sharing tests due to stale proxied items
    • 7042 thisandfuture after this modification problem
    • 6775 Jump calendar slowdown with r11830 (stamping as annotation)
    • Tracked down a couple of intermittent tinderbox failures (7034, 7042).
    • α4 bug status:
      • 6815 (stamping the welcome note): Testing patch.
      • 6798 (modification edge cases): Fix requires patch in 6551.
      • 6884 (Chandler died after sitting idle for a bit): Waiting for more info from pdb.
  • Plan

Morgen

  • Progress
    • Fixed bug 6964 ("Default" accounts not being set properly, plus need unit test for settings.py)
    • Investigated not rolling back sharing view during sync, and discussed option with Andi, Grant and Jeffrey
    • Investigated bug 6994 (sharing inconsistencies), and figured out that timezones were not being persisted correctly.
    • Fixed bug 6874 (Commit after adding subscribed collection to sidebar)
    • Fixed bug 6899 (Talkback window pops up when trying to restore settings)
    • Fixed bug 6907 (Save 'Start logging' to .ini settings file)
    • Fixed bug 6970 (Events disappearing after sync of calendar)
    • Fixed bug 7041 (Intermittent tinderbox sharing test failure: 'NoneType' has no attribute 'itsView')
    • Fixed bug 7054 (Items removed from server aren't being removed locally)
    • Fixed bug 7062 (Recurrence rule merge error while restoring my work collection)
    • Fixed bug 7074 (reminder assert causes twisted to get funky)
    • Fixed bug 7087 (Changing a collection's online/offline status may not take effect)
    • Fixed bug 7086 (Hitting ESC in a Yes/No dialog raises an exception)
    • Fixed bug 7088 (Chandler should send User-Agent header)
  • Plan

Bear

  • Progress
    • Fixed bug 6413 (Chandler should refuse to run on the wrong architecture)
    • Fixed bug 6450 (Chandler terminates as soon as it is launched)
    • Fixed bug 6574 (chandler.log not appended to tbox log on Windows quick builds)
    • Fixed bug 6713 (plugins can't live in CHANDLERBIN)
    • Fixed bug 6971 (Upgrade parsedatetime library)
    • Fixed bug 7011 (checkpoint 10-09-06 only works on winXP, chandler won't start)
    • Fixed bug 7025 (Cannot launch Latest OSX build)
    • Fixed bug 7038 (add install-plugin-core target to Makefile)
    • Fixed bug 7059 (change getPlatformName() to only return "Windows")
    • Fixed bug 7065 (egg_translations import errors when using end-user installer)
  • Plan
    • work on remaining two bugs
    • Prepare for release candidates for both Chandler and Cosmo
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r7 < r6 < r5 < r4 < r3 | More topic actions
 
Open Source Applications Foundation
Except where otherwise noted, this site and its content are licensed by OSAF under an Creative Commons License, Attribution Only 3.0.
See list of page contributors for attributions.